Your Skin Has Its Own Immune System

Most people know the skin protects against germs, but it also has specialized immune cells called Langerhans cells that constantly “patrol” for invaders.

  • These cells detect harmful bacteria and viruses and alert your immune system, acting like tiny bodyguards.
  • Fun fact: This is why small cuts or scrapes often turn red quickly — it’s your skin’s immune response kicking in before the rest of your body even reacts.
